Dispatcher Interview Questions
You can expect the interview for a dispatcher position to revolve around your communication and multitasking skills. Employers will want to make sure you can learn how to retrieve appropriate information from callers and relay necessary information in a timely manner. Prepare to provide examples of instances when you prioritized a list of tasks you had to complete in a short amount of time or explained a difficult concept to a coworker.
